Do you like a big blockhead who thinks he's a lap dog? If so, you'll love Tiny Tim! Seriously, this guy really identifies with the "tiny" part of his name. Nothing you say will convince him he isn't the same size as a chihuahua. In addition to squeezing into laps, Tiny Tim has many "favorites" in life: Treats, snuggles, and taking naps. (Fun fact: He prefers a cold floor with a blanket over a soft bed.) Be warned, though: Tiny Tim is known for sneaking in a big ole' kiss whenever he can. If you're looking for a teeny, tiny, itty bitty, baby dog who just happens to weigh 65+ pounds -- congratulations, you just found him!

More about this shelter
We are a non-profit animal shelter started in 1974 to serve pets and people. Our mission is to promote the welfare of companion animals and to nurture loving, lifelong relationships between animals and people. In addition to adoption, we have a Veterinary Clinic that provides wellness and spay/neuter services, and we have a Help Center that provides services to help keep pets and families together.
